What causes this issue with the step tracker

A bug was identified in Shelf version 14.6.0, affecting users across all regions, particularly in India.


How to resolve this issue with the step tracker

Update Shelf App:

  1. Open the Google Play Store or your device's built-in app market.

  2. Search for [Shelf].

  3. If an update is available, tap [Update].


Check for App Updates:

  1. Navigate to [Settings] > [Apps] > [App management].

  2. Locate and tap [Shelf].

  3. Select [App info].

  4. Look for the App version. If it's not 14.6.2, tap [Update] (if available).

    

Note:

  • Updating Shelf may require a stable internet connection.

  • If the issue persists after updating, please contact OPPO customer support for further assistance.
